The Growing Power of Netflix in the Streaming Landscape

The Netflix-Warner Brothers deal signifies a crucial turning point in the streaming industry, affirming Netflix’s status as a formidable player. By acquiring Warner Brothers Discovery’s extensive library and HBO’s established streaming network, Netflix is not just amassing content; it is also consolidating its power over subscription services. The integration of HBO’s massive subscriber base enhances Netflix’s reach, potentially placing over 128 million additional viewers under its banner, which could solidify its market dominance against emerging competition.

This acquisition is indicative of a broader trend within the industry where major players aim to control vast content libraries to secure consumer loyalty. With the ongoing shifts in viewer preferences toward binge-watching and on-demand content, Netflix’s investment translates into a rich diversity of programming that caters to varied tastes. This strategic move is likely to instill a sense of ‘untouchability’ in Netflix’s offerings, further contributing to its already expansive catalog and unique positioning within the streaming ecosystem.

The Future of Subscription Prices Post-Acquisition

As the Netflix-Warner Brothers deal unfolds, one of the most pressing questions revolves around its impact on subscription pricing. Analysts remain divided on whether the merger will prompt an increase or decrease in monthly fees for consumers. While the brand equity of HBO might suggest premium pricing strategies, the potential for bundling and improved collections of services can also lead to competitive pricing models that favor consumers. If Netflix were to effectively integrate HBO’s offerings, it may reduce costs into a more attractive combined service that retains subscribers.

However, market power dynamics cannot be ignored. The acquisition could empower Netflix to elevate prices without fear of losing significant subscriber traction— a possibility that has many viewers concerned. As competitors navigate this new landscape, the implications for consumer choice and affordability in subscription-based streaming services are uncertain. The balance Netflix strikes between offering value and leveraging its dominance will significantly shape the market in the months to come.

Navigating Regulatory Challenges in Major Media Mergers

While the Netflix-Warner Brothers deal seems promising, it is not without its hurdles. The merger will have to navigate a labyrinth of regulatory approvals, particularly as Warner Brothers Discovery works to spin off certain assets to make the acquisition viable. The implications of media consolidation on consumer choice and market competition have raised eyebrows among regulators, especially in the U.S. and Europe, where scrutiny over large media mergers has intensified in recent years. The outcome of this regulatory review could have profound effects on how the merger unfolds.

Moreover, the ongoing discussions around antitrust laws and media concentration could serve as obstacles for Netflix, as lawmakers express concerns about the implications for pricing and diversity in the media landscape. The scrutiny surrounding this deal underscores the complexities involved, making the approval process a critical aspect to monitor as both companies work to finalize the acquisition before entering a new phase of operation within the streaming industry.
